Older adults who "train" for a major operation by exercising, eating a healthy diet, and practicing stress reduction techniques preoperatively have shorter hospital stays and are more likely to return to their own homes afterward rather than another facility, compared with similar patients who do not participate in preoperative rehabilitation, according to research findings.
RegeneRx Biopharmaceuticals, Inc. has announced that thymosin beta 4 (Tβ4) can activate a unique subpopulation of resident adult epicardial stem cells such that they recapture embryonic potential, proliferate, migrate and differentiate into functional heart muscle (cardiomyocytes), according to a research paper published online today in Nature.
Moderate alcohol consumption over a relatively long period of time can enhance the formation of new nerve cells in the adult brain. The new cells could prove important in the development of alcohol dependency and other long-term effects of alcohol on the brain. The findings are published by Karolinska Institutet.
